Eszopiclone is a nonbenzodiazepine active pharmaceutical ingredient used in medications for the short-term and long-term management of insomnia. It is one of the few FDA-regulated hypnotic compounds without prescribed limits on treatment duration, with evidence supporting benefits for up to six months and potential efficacy beyond one year.
